Nadler: Bill Has $231,000 for Brooklyn Youth Business Career Development
Washington, DC,
July 1, 2007
Congressman Jerrold Nadler (NY-08), who represents parts of Manhattan and Brooklyn, hailed the passage of the Financial Services and General Government Appropriations bill. That measure, adopted last week, includes $231,000 for a new youth business career development project to be run by the Brooklyn-based Sephardic Angel Fund. The spending bill must still be reconciled with the Senate before heading to the President for his signature.
